Delaware Code § 3-7321

Blood test upon request of owner
Open in Lexace · Ask the AI about this section
The Department of Agriculture may take under supervision, whenever the Department deems it advisable, such herds of cattle as the
owners request, for the conducting of the blood test for Bang's disease (brucellosis), if the owners requesting this service agree to conform
to the rules and regulations promulgated by the Department of Agriculture for the control and eradication of the disease.
